This app streamlines canal water management for irrigation districts, canal companies, and farmers. It facilitates coordination of water delivery, management of change orders, and logging of field readings. Users can map infrastructure, monitor water usage, and communicate with stakeholders.

What is WaterRoutes used for?
WaterRoutes is an operating system designed for canal water management. It helps coordinate water delivery from the office to the field for irrigation districts, canal companies, and farmers.
Who is the target audience for WaterRoutes?
The app is built for irrigation districts, canal companies, water masters, ditch riders, and farmers who need to manage water delivery and operations.
What kind of reports can WaterRoutes generate?
WaterRoutes can generate email and PDF reports for daily operations, including water delivery and account balance reports. It also supports sending scheduled reports.
Does WaterRoutes offer mapping features?
Yes, WaterRoutes includes interactive maps to visualize canal infrastructure. This helps in managing and understanding the water delivery network.
How does WaterRoutes handle communication?
The app facilitates communication with users through broadcasts and notifications. It also allows for general user communication within the platform.
